conclure

/kɔ̃.klyʁ/
FRANSIZCA → TR
Fransızca "conclure" kelimesi Türkçe'de (konuyu) özetlemek, (konuyu) toparlamak, (toplantıya, işe) son vermek, (toplantıyı, işi) bitirmek, bitirmek anlamına gelir.
